pandas 二维表与一维记录的转换
因为这个很常用,又忘记了好几次,故记录一下。这个题目估计取的不行,有更好的描述以后再换。
1. 二维到一维
dataframe.stack().reset_index().rename({"???":"???"}, axis=1)
# 问号处内容请自己观察一下前一步结果填写
做的事情就是把下面左图(上图)变成右图(下图)
2. 一维到二维
参考上面两张图的效果
default_value=0
dataframe.set_index(list(dataframe.columns[:2])).unstack(fill_value=default_value)
dataframe.columns = dataframe.columns.droplevel(0)
pandas 二维表与一维记录的转换相关推荐
- 数据建模中的二维表和一维表!
[讨论] 什么是表/一维表/二维表,哪位给个准确的定义 [复制链接] 透视表要求是一维表, 那什么是表.一维表.二维表呢?查了一下午也没有找到准确的定义, 把找到的内容罗列如下: ++++++++++ ...
- python二维表转一维表_曾贤志从零基础开始学用Python处理Excel数据第1,2季
教程简介: =====[曾贤志]从零基础开始用Python处理Excel数据====== 1-1 什么是python? .mp4 1-2 为什么要学习用Python处理Excel表格? .mp4 1- ...
- python二维表转一维表_Excel、Power BI及Python系列:使用Power BI转化一维表与二维表...
上篇文章,老海分享了如何使用Excel完成一维表与二维表之间的转化 本篇老家继续分享使用Power BI来完成一维表与二维表的转化操作. 可能很多小伙伴,不太了解Power BI Power BI是什 ...
- 二维表 转一维表 mysql_Excel二维表转换成一维表(2种方法)
今天大年初四,春节假期还剩三天了,每逢佳节胖三斤,亲们可要注意控制饮食了,要不然春节后无脸见人哟.闲话少说,今日分享如下. 在做数据处理的时候,有的时候为了处理方便我们需要将二维的数据表处理成一维的数 ...
- excel2016 for mac 二维表转一维表
数据分析过程中,对一维表进行数据处理比对二维表方便,因此经常需要用到二维表转一维表的操作.<谁说菜鸟不懂数据分析>一书以及网络上能查到的有两种方法:一是利用数据透视表和数据透视图向导(包括 ...
- 二维表转换为一维列表
二维表转换为一维列表 秀秀:哎?俺发现一个问题:最近好像你很谦虚,总是听俺在说"理论",你的小聪明哪去了? 阿金:俺和你不一样,尽研究一些表面文章,俺研究的是数据理论,很高雅的 秀 ...
- python二维表转一维表_【习题】一维表转二维表
今天来看看梁总出的练习题哈 转换成下面的二维表效果图(要求:必须要跟效果表一致) 方法1: 小子大神Python: import xlrd import xlwt s = set() d = {} a ...
- MySQL二维表转一维表
在mysql里怎么把二维表转成一维表(从图1变为图2),二维表里有很多很多列,列数很多的情况下使用union all逐个拼接查询结果,这种方法太繁琐,有没有更高效的办法?? 图1("化学&q ...
- KNIME中使用Unpivoting将二维表转为一维表
出现问题 因为是中文数据,使用CSV READER读取后出现乱码,同时Unpivoting中也出现乱码. 在该NOTE中设置字符: 原始数据 原表数据,从图中可以看出是二维表,不利于数据分析,目标是保 ...
- python二维表转一维表_二维表格转换成一维表格
# 加载数据 import pandas as pd df_old1 = pd.read_excel(r"D:\Jupyter\data\Python.xlsx",sheet_na ...
最新文章
- Linux 网卡驱动相关——03
- python cnn_Python · CNN(一)· 层结构
- 微软模拟飞行10厦门航空涂装_《微软飞行模拟器》多人游戏模式演示:可组队飞行...
- redis 哨兵模式 cluster模式区别_Redis哨兵(Sentinel)模式快速入门
- xamarin误删vEthernet(internal Ethernet Port Windows Phone Emulator) 网络设备的处理。
- linux常见功能代码,几种功能类似Linux命令汇总(示例代码)
- Excel多表头导出(.net)
- goaccess分析nginx日志
- NC单点登录设置默认界面
- 使用readelf和objdump剖析目标文件
- Abaqus Ncode振动疲劳分析教程
- Android系统启动过程-uBoot+Kernel+Android
- Matlab2019b中配置最小均方误差滤波器(dsp.LMSFilter)详细设置
- 华为交换机审计配置_华为交换机AAA配置管理.doc
- 亚马逊新手卖家如何快速出单必掌握的运营技巧分享?
- 1010001b 1101110b怎么用计算机,计算机组成原理计算题
- 用SSH工具XShell连接云服务器 root用户 (谷歌云 甲骨文通用)
- html的img标签repeat,border-image-repeat属性怎么用
- python编程从入门到实践 第18章Django入门 2022年最新
- 网际协议IP---ARP协议